The Role
Rogo is hiring a Customer Trust Lead to own our customer trust, security assurance, and compliance programs as we scale globally. You'll be the person who ensures that when our customers ask hard questions about our security posture, they get clear, accurate, and timely answers. This is a hands‑on, high‑ownership role. You'll spend a significant amount of your time directly engaging with customers, leading security review calls, navigating due diligence processes, and building trusted relationships with enterprise security and risk teams. Alongside that, you'll be deep in security questionnaires, customer risk assessments, and due diligence reviews, while building the processes and documentation that let this function scale. You'll work across Security, Engineering, Legal, and Sales to make sure what we say matches what we do, and that we’re always getting better at both.
What You Will Own
- Customer‑facing security engagements, leading calls with enterprise security and risk teams, articulating Rogo’s security architecture, and building the trusted relationships that give customers confidence to move forward.
- End‑to‑end lifecycle of customer security questionnaires, due diligence reviews, and third‑party risk assessments, ensuring every response is accurate, consistent, and reinforces customer confidence in Rogo.
- Rogo’s response library: standardised answers, evidence packages, and reusable content that turn every review into an opportunity to move faster next time.
- Compliance across frameworks relevant to our customers and jurisdictions: SOC 2, ISO 27001, ISO 42001, EU AI Act, UK Cyber Essentials, and GDPR, including evidence collection and audit coordination.
- Trust documentation: security whitepapers, architecture overviews, control narratives, and customer‑facing FAQs, partnering with Security and Engineering to translate technical controls into language that builds confidence with enterprise risk teams.
- Pattern recognition across customer inquiries, surfacing recurring themes and gaps and feeding those insights back into our security and compliance roadmap.
- Scalable workflows and tooling that keep pace with our growing customer base and increasingly sophisticated enterprise requirements.
Great Candidates Often:
- Have 5+ years of experience in GRC, compliance, or customer‑facing security roles at a SaaS or cloud‑native company.
- Have a strong technical foundation, comfortable with architecture diagrams, network security controls, encryption, IAM, and container security.
- Have spent real time working through security questionnaires and customer due diligence, and have opinions on how to do it better.
- Can translate complex technical security concepts into clear, precise written and live responses.
- Understand common enterprise security expectations across cloud infrastructure, access control, data protection, and incident response.
- Are highly organised and thrive managing many parallel workstreams without dropping things.
- Have a bias toward building repeatable processes rather than heroically firefighting every request.
Bonus:
- Experience supporting financial services customers on security, risk, and compliance topics.
- Exposure to cloud security concepts (GCP/AWS, Kubernetes, IAM).
- Experience building and implementing trust automation or questionnaire management platforms.
- Relevant certifications (CISA, CRISC, CISM, CISSP, ISO 27001 Lead Auditor).
- Familiarity with AI‑specific compliance considerations (EU AI Act, ISO 42001, model security).
